What are the most common dermatology services available to patients from Guild, TN?

Local and regional dermatology clinics serving the Guild area typically offer comprehensive services including skin cancer screenings (especially important given Tennessee's sun exposure), treatment for acne, eczema, and psoriasis, and procedures like biopsies, cryotherapy, and lesion removals. Many also provide cosmetic services such as treatment for sun damage, Botox, and filler injections.

Are there dermatologists in the region who specialize in treating skin conditions common in rural Tennessee, like serious sun damage or agricultural-related skin issues?

Yes, dermatologists in clinics serving Cumberland County and the surrounding area are experienced in managing conditions prevalent in the region. This includes the diagnosis and treatment of actinic keratoses and skin cancers resulting from cumulative sun exposure, as well as contact dermatitis or infections that may be associated with outdoor and agricultural work common in the Guild community.

What is the typical process for scheduling a first-time appointment and how long is the wait for a dermatologist near Guild?

To schedule an appointment, you will typically need a referral from your primary care provider in Guild or Crossville, especially for insurance purposes. New patient wait times can vary from a few weeks to a couple of months, depending on the practice and the urgency of your condition. For concerning moles or rapidly changing skin lesions, be sure to communicate the urgency to the scheduler, as many offices can accommodate more prompt evaluations for potential skin cancers.
